A 5000 seat theater has tickets for sale at 26 and 40. How many tickets should be sold at each price for a sellout performance t
slavikrds [6]

Answer:

The number of tickets for sale at $26 should be 3300

The number of tickets for sale at $40 should be 1700

Step-by-step explanation:

Use 2 equations to represent the modifiers within the problem:

5000 = a + b \\ 153800 = 26a + 40b

Now you want to find the point at which the variables are changed to make both equations correct, this can be done by graphing and finding the intersection of both lines.

5000 = 3300 + 1700 \\ 153800 = 26(3300) + 40(1700)

A tool that regulary sells for $18.50 is on for 20 % off what is the sale price?
denis23 [38]
So 
<span>20% of 18.50 = ____ </span>

<span>to get this you multiply </span>
<span>20% is .20 in decimal form </span>

<span>18.50 x .20 = $3.70 </span>

<span>so 20% is $3.70, which means the discount is $3.70 </span>

<span>so then you subtract $3.70 from the original price of 18.50 and you get </span>

<span>$14.80 which is your answer (:</span>
